Microsoft has given us another sneak peek into their upcoming Windows 10 Sun Valley design update with a refresh of the Windows system icons. Microsoft has been storing their system icons for folders, devices, settings, control panels, and applications in the C:WindowsSystem32Shell32.dll file. In Windows 10 20H2, there are currently 334 icons in Shell32.DLL that have not been updated in quite some time. The Sun Valley update is expected to be released in Fall 2021. Not all of the icons have been updated yet but will likely be done or removed altogether.
